How they compare
Uruguay currently reports 456,272 against 455,064 in Albania, a difference of 1,208.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 26 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Albania ahead.
Albania ranks 131st and Uruguay ranks 130th of 191 countries.
Albania has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Albania | Uruguay |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 567,555 | 479,694 | 87,861 | Albania |
| 2000s | 560,951 | 475,002 | 85,948 | Albania |
| 2010s | 478,540 | 465,660 | 12,880 | Albania |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
